    Benefits of Plantation Red Chandan Plant in Pilkhuwa

    1. High Commercial Value

    Red Chandan is highly prized in international markets, especially in China, Japan, and Southeast Asia, where it is used in traditional medicine, religious rituals, perfumes, and luxury furniture. The heartwood of Red Sandalwood fetches a very high price, sometimes even more than gold, making it a highly lucrative crop for long-term investment.

    2. Eco-Friendly and Sustainable

    The Plantation Red Chandan Plant in Pilkhuwa supports green initiatives by promoting afforestation and carbon sequestration. Red Sandalwood trees absorb carbon dioxide and release oxygen, contributing to a healthier environment. This plantation also reduces soil erosion and enhances soil fertility over time.

    3. Low Maintenance and High Returns

    Red Chandan trees require minimal maintenance after the first few years of planting. Once established, they are resilient to drought and pests. With a gestation period of 12–15 years for harvesting, a well-managed plantation can yield substantial profits, with minimal recurring costs.

    4. Government Support and Subsidies

    Various state and central government schemes in India support agroforestry and tree plantation initiatives. Farmers and entrepreneurs involved in the Plantation Red Chandan Plant in Pilkhuwa may be eligible for subsidies, technical support, and insurance under forestry and agroforestry promotion programs.

    5. Employment and Rural Development

    Large-scale Red Chandan plantation projects create job opportunities in nursery development, plantation management, irrigation, pruning, protection, and harvesting. This helps in improving the socio-economic conditions of rural communities in and around Pilkhuwa.


    How to Start Plantation Red Chandan Plant in Pilkhuwa

    1. Land Selection and Preparation

    Choose well-drained loamy or red soil with a slightly acidic to neutral pH (6.5–7.5). Clear the land of weeds and prepare it by deep ploughing. Proper leveling and trenching should be done to ensure healthy root development.

    2. Plant Selection

    Use high-quality Red Chandan saplings from certified nurseries. Tissue-cultured or grafted plants often have better survival rates and faster growth compared to regular seedlings.

    3. Spacing and Plantation Technique

    Red Sandalwood trees should be planted at a spacing of 10×10 ft or 12×12 ft depending on land size and soil fertility. Each pit should be 1.5 ft deep and filled with a mixture of compost, red soil, and neem cake to support initial growth.

    4. Irrigation and Fertilization

    In the initial 1–2 years, regular watering is crucial. After establishment, Red Chandan trees become drought-tolerant. Organic manures and biofertilizers can be applied annually for enhanced growth. Avoid overwatering, as waterlogging can damage the roots.

    5. Pest and Disease Management

    Although Red Sandalwood is relatively resistant to diseases, routine inspection and use of organic pesticides can prevent any pest attacks. Use neem oil or bio-pesticides as a preventive measure.

    6. Intercropping and Income Generation

    During the initial years, farmers can grow intercrops like turmeric, ginger, or pulses between the rows of Red Chandan to generate supplementary income. This also helps in weed management and improves soil health.


    Market Potential of Red Chandan from Pilkhuwa

    The global demand for Red Sandalwood continues to rise due to its rarity and multiple uses. It is widely used in:

    • Ayurvedic and Chinese medicine

    • Spiritual and religious ceremonies

    • Aromatherapy and cosmetics

    • High-end handicrafts and decorative items

    • Musical instruments and antique furniture

    Once matured, the heartwood of each Red Chandan tree can weigh between 20–25 kg, with current market rates ranging from ₹5,000 to ₹15,000 per kg depending on quality and grade. With over 400 trees per acre, the potential earnings from a matured Plantation Red Chandan Plant in Pilkhuwa can run into crores.


    Legal Aspects and Permissions

    Growing Red Sandalwood in India is legal but regulated. Farmers must register their plantation with the local forest department. Permission is required before felling and transporting the harvested wood. In Uttar Pradesh, the state government has taken steps to simplify these processes, especially for private landowners.
